Aviva's Q1 2022 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2022, Aviva held 1,124 positions worth $20B, down 16% from $23.9B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 22% of the portfolio.
Aviva withdrew a net $3.51B in Q1 2022, closing 65 positions and reducing 439 holdings. Its most notable exit was Valvoline, an estimated $28.8M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 24% of assets, up from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
Against the trend, Aviva opened a new position in Constellation Energy worth $22.7M.
